Asim's square up coding challenge

#!python3 | |
def square_up(n): | |
"""Simple test cases in docstring | |
>>> square_up(2) | |
[0, 1, 2, 1] | |
>>> square_up(3) | |
[0, 0, 1, 0, 2, 1, 3, 2, 1] | |
>>> square_up(4) | |
[0, 0, 0, 1, 0, 0, 2, 1, 0, 3, 2, 1, 4, 3, 2, 1] | |
>>> square_up(5) | |
[0, 0, 0, 0, 1, 0, 0, 0, 2, 1, 0, 0, 3, 2, 1, 0, 4, 3, 2, 1, 5, 4, 3, 2, 1] | |
""" | |
a = [] | |
# Loop in 2 dimensions, as a matrix (row i, column j) | |
for i in range(n): | |
for j in range(n): | |
# Upper left triangle | |
if i+j < n-1: | |
a.append(0) | |
# Lower right triangle | |
else: | |
a.append(n-j) | |
# Equivalent tertiary expression | |
# a.append(0 if i+j < n-1 else n-j) | |
# return a | |
# Equivalent list comprehension | |
return [0 if i+j < n-1 else n-j for i in range(n) for j in range(n)] | |
if __name__ == '__main__': | |
import sys | |
n = int(sys.argv[1]) if len(sys.argv) > 1 else 4 | |
print(square_up(n)) | |
# Run docstring tests | |
import doctest | |
doctest.testmod() |
